August 31, 1943 – October 6, 2017
University Park, Iowa | Age 74

Sandra Klein, 74, of University Park, died Friday, October 6, 2017, at the MHP Hospice Serenity House in Oskaloosa. She was born August 31, 1943, the daughter of Gilbert and Lena (Kaluzne) Pefferman.

Following school, she was united in marriage to Larry Dean Sparks. To this union two children were born, Tim and Lisa. Sandra and Larry later divorced.

Sandra worked for several years at Younkers in Oskaloosa.

On December 20, 1973, she was united in marriage to Alvin Klein in Ottumwa. Following their marriage Sandra joined Alvin on the farm near Cedar. From that time on she stayed home to care for her family and home. Alvin died on April 2, 2008. Following Alvin’s death, Sandra moved into University Park to be closer to her family.

Sandra enjoyed watching NASCAR, cheering for the Hawkeyes basketball and football teams, and rooting for the Chicago Bears. She also enjoyed feeding and watching the birds and other wildlife around her home. She was a devoted wife, mother, and grandmother. She delighted in being around her family.

Her family includes her two children and their spouses, Tim (& Ruth) Sparks of University Park and Lisa (& Bruce) Lewis of Oskaloosa; five grandchildren: Nicole (& Andy) Stock, Holly (& Jesse) Greenhalgh, Sara Lewis, Kelli (& Charlie) Fleener, and Matt (& Jaimie) Sparks; 12 great grandchildren: Jett, Griffin, Jaxson, Rylan, Mattix, Luke, Chase, Kinsley, Stuart, Darcy, Oliver, and Piper; brothers and sisters in law, Joe Beal, Jr., Darrell (& Joyce) Klein, Luane Tyrrel; and many nieces and nephews.

In addition to her husband Alvin; Sandy was preceded in death by her parents; two brothers, George in infancy and Steve Pefferman; and a sister, Mary Beal; her father and mother in law, Elmer and Nellie Klein; and a brother in law, Jack Tyrrel.
